Delivery Driver 
Refurbishment & Warehouse duties 
Grays, Essex 
£26,000 + per annum 

Are you an experienced Delivery Driver with warehouse or workshop experience?

Looking for a role that offers variety, hands-on work, and the chance to learn new skills? If so, this could be the perfect opportunity for you.

You’ll be joining a well-established and growing business that supplies premium, energy-efficient water systems to customers across the UK. Known for its focus on quality, sustainability, and exceptional service, this company operates in a fast-paced environment where every team member plays an important role.

This is a fantastic chance to become part of a supportive, close-knit team, where you’ll gain valuable experience across multiple areas — from driving and logistics to warehouse operations and light refurbishment work.

The Role:
  • Safely deliver refurbished and new products or materials across Central London and surrounding areas.
  • Load and unload vehicles efficiently, planning routes for timely deliveries.
  • Complete all delivery documentation and perform daily vehicle safety checks.
  • Use hand and power tools to carry out basic refurbishment, cleaning, and repair of returned or damaged products.
  • Inspect, clean, and reassemble components to meet company standards.
  • Support general warehouse operations, including goods in/out, picking, packing, and stock management.
  • Operate forklifts safely (a valid licence is required).
  • Work closely with both warehouse and workshop teams to achieve daily productivity and quality targets.
What You’ll Need
  • Proven delivery driving experience, ideally across London or other busy urban areas.
  • Practical, hands-on experience in a warehouse, logistics, or workshop environment.
  • Confident using basic tools for light repairs or refurbishments.
  • A valid UK driving licence
  • Valid Forklift license (or previous license)
  • A strong work ethic, attention to detail, and a proactive approach to problem-solving.

The Package:
  • Starting salary from £26,000 per annum
  • Training provided on certain aspects of the role. 
  • Wellbeing platforms, including 24-hour Dr.
  • Career progression into other areas of the business.
